Congrats on your acceptance,

the book Katie is referring to, is called Fundamentals Success, and it is very good. In first semester you will be exposed to NCLEX type questions for the first time, which are so different than what you are used to from prereqs. This book really helps and has all subjects covered for first semester with nothing but questions and rationals. It is definitely worth the money. You can also invest in a good NCLEX review book (Saunders Review is very good), this will help you over the course of your 2 years and for NCLEX. It has some fundamentals in it, but not as in depth as the above mentioned book.

I bought the box of books with CD the first semester, but did not utilize the Cd's very much, so for me it was a waste of money. And from then on I have been buying all my books used on Amazon, and only spend about half of what the box cost each semester. I have not missed the Cd's.

I use the book box CD's, and hardly ever open the books.

I like to be able to put a word in, and the evolve software searches for that word in all the books. That way you can get all the info for a certain topic, without having to read pages and pages trying to find something that may not be in the glossary or index.
